The Child Star Who Became TV’s Highest-Paid Kid Actor

Angus T. Jones was born in Austin, Texas, in 1993 and began acting in commercials before kindergarten. By age five, he had already appeared in films, and at six he landed a lead role in the family comedy See Spot Run.

His career changed forever in 2003 when he was cast as Jake Harper on Two and a Half Men. The producers reportedly offered him the role almost immediately after his audition.

At the height of the show’s popularity, Jones was earning an estimated $300,000 per episode, making him one of the highest-paid child actors in television history.

The sitcom regularly drew around 15 million viewers per episode and became one of the most successful comedies of its era.

Jake Harper’s Evolution on the Show

Jake started as a naïve, funny kid delivering surprisingly sharp one-liners. Over the years, the character grew older and took on more adult storylines involving dating, partying, and eventually joining the military.

That shift reportedly became uncomfortable for Jones, who underwent a major personal and spiritual transformation during the show’s run.



Why Angus T. Jones Left Hollywood

In 2012, Jones publicly criticized Two and a Half Men, calling it “filth” and urging people to stop watching it. He said he had become deeply religious after joining the Seventh-day Adventist Church and no longer felt comfortable participating in the series.

“I was a paid hypocrite because I wasn’t OK with it and I was still doing it.”

The comments shocked fans and created tension behind the scenes. Jones later apologized to creator Chuck Lorre for speaking so harshly, but he still stood by his decision to leave the show.

He officially exited the sitcom in 2014 and largely disappeared from the entertainment industry.

Life After Fame

After leaving Hollywood, Jones moved to Colorado and attended the University of Colorado Boulder, where he studied religion. He described enjoying the experience of being treated like a normal student instead of a celebrity.

He briefly returned to acting in 2016 with an appearance in the web series Horace and Pete, but otherwise stayed out of the spotlight.



What Angus T. Jones Looks Like Today

Now in his early 30s, Angus T. Jones looks dramatically different from the clean-cut sitcom kid audiences remember. Recent photos show him with long hair, a full beard, and a much more rugged style.

He keeps a very low profile, rarely gives interviews, and only occasionally posts on social media. Reports suggest he spends much of his time living quietly in California and focusing on personal interests rather than acting.
